title = "Radiotherapy and immune checkpoint blockade: Potential interactions and future directions",
abstract = "Combining radiation and immune checkpoint blockade provides synergistic antitumor responses in animal models and a small subset of patients. New preclinical data have provided mechanistic insight into this treatment interaction and identification of therapeutic targets to optimize this approach.",
